The Ethical Considerations of Time Travel and Moral Dilemmas
Time travel has long been a fascinating concept in science fiction, but what ethical considerations would arise if it were possible in reality? Let's delve into the potential ethical dilemmas and moral quandaries that time travel could bring.
Ethical Considerations of Time Travel
1. Changing the Course of History: One of the most significant ethical dilemmas of time travel is the potential to alter historical events. Would changing the past have unforeseen consequences on the present and future?
2. Impact on Personal Identity: If someone were to travel back in time and interact with their past self, what would be the implications for their personal identity? Would it cause psychological harm or a paradoxical existence?
3. Power Dynamics: Time travel could create power imbalances, allowing individuals to manipulate the past for personal gain or to control outcomes. How could this be regulated to prevent abuse?
Moral Dilemmas of Time Travel
1. Intervening to Prevent Tragedies: If one had the ability to go back in time and prevent a historical tragedy, such as a natural disaster or war, should they intervene? Would altering such events be justified?
2. Knowledge of Future Events: Knowing future events through time travel raises questions of accountability and the obligation to prevent harm. Should individuals act on future knowledge, even if it means altering the natural course of events?
3. Temporal Ethics: How do we define ethical behavior across different time periods? What may be morally acceptable in one era could be considered unethical in another.
Conclusion
Time travel poses intriguing ethical considerations and moral dilemmas that challenge our understanding of cause and effect, personal agency, and societal values. While the concept of time travel remains theoretical, contemplating these ethical issues can deepen our reflection on the impact of our actions and decisions, both in the present and potentially in the past or future.
